Three Reasons To Keep Accurate Financial Records
Here are three of the most important reasons to keep accurate financial records in your business.
1. Compliance
Accurate financial records are essential if you want to meet legal and regulatory requirements, such as calculating and paying sales tax, income tax filings and financial reporting obligations. Non-compliance can result in penalties, fines, and legal consequences for your business.
2. Informed Decision Making
Accurate record keeping gives you confidence in the reports you look at. With these reports you can understand your financial health and make informed decisions. You can analyze income, expenses, cash flow, and profitability, facilitating budgeting, forecasting, and strategic planning.
3. Stakeholder Communication
If you need to communicate your business’s financial performance to stakeholders, such as shareholders, investors, lenders, and partners, you’ll need good recording keeping. Reliable records build trust, credibility, and transparency, fostering strong relationships and opening doors to potential opportunities.

How Do You Maintain Accurate Financial Records?
There are a number of ways that professional bookkeeping services keep accurate financial records.
Organizing & Categorizing Transactions
The starting point is putting in place a clear filing system for financial documents, such as invoices, receipts, and bank statements. Transactions should be categorized based on income, expenses, assets, and liabilities for easier tracking and analysis. Depending on the volume of transactions this can be done daily, weekly or monthly.
Using Accounting Software
Professional bookkeeping services use accounting software to simplify how your financial transactions are recorded and tracked. This is reliable software that allows for automation, generating reports, and organizing data efficiently.

Reconciling Bank Statements
Bank account statements and credit card statements should be regularly reconciled with your financial records to identify any discrepancies or errors. Reconciliation ensures that all transactions are accurately recorded and helps uncover any missing or incorrect entries. If you’re using accounting software, a lot of these reconciliations can be ‘mapped’ and automated.
Tracking Income & Expenses
All income and expenses should be recorded promptly and accurately. Details such as dates, amounts, and descriptions should be included in record keeping to provide a comprehensive description of your financial activities.
Supporting Documentation
Professional bookkeeping services will have a system in place to retain all relevant supporting documentation, such as receipts, invoices, and contracts. These documents serve as evidence of transactions and can be crucial for audits, tax filings, and financial analysis. As a rule of thumb it’s a good idea to keep business records for up to seven years in case of an IRS audit. With modern accounting software all of these records can be securely digitized and stored in the cloud.
Conducting Reviews
Good bookkeepers will set aside time to review your financial records periodically. They check for any inconsistencies, outliers, or potential errors.

What is one of the most common bookkeeping mistakes that business owners make?
One of the most common bookkeeping mistakes that business owners make is neglecting to separate personal and business finances. Many entrepreneurs mix personal and business expenses, using the same bank accounts and credit cards for both. This makes it challenging to track and accurately record business transactions, leading to confusion, errors, and potential tax issues. It is crucial to establish separate bank accounts and credit cards specifically for business purposes.
